ext2 root filesystems are always dirty in Red Hat Enterprise Linux 6 Rescue Mode
Issue
- If you install Red Hat Enterprise Linux 6.0 onto an ext2 root filesystem and then try a rescue boot, anaconda complains that the root filesystem is dirty:
-------------------------------------------------------------- Dirty File Systems The following file systems for your Linux system were not unmounted cleanly. Would you like to mount them anyway? /dev/mapper/vg_vm23-lv_root [ Yes ] [ No ] ---------------------------------------------------------------
